Gemeinsame Aliasse

Bei der Arbeit mit der Google Ads API werden E-Mail-Adressen an mehreren Stellen für die Kontakt- und Zugriffsverwaltung verwendet. Die wichtigsten sind die folgenden:

  • E-Mail-Adresse für Google Ads API-Kontakt: Das ist die E-Mail-Adresse, die im API Center der Google Ads-Benutzeroberfläche als Kontakt aufgeführt ist.
  • E-Mail-Adresse des Google Cloud Console-Kontos: Dies ist die E-Mail-Adresse, die Administratorzugriff auf das Google Cloud Console-Konto hat, das für Ihre OAuth 2.0-Anwendung verwendet wird.
  • E-Mail-Adressen für Google Ads-Verwaltungskonten: Dies sind die E-Mail-Adressen, die Administratorberechtigungen für die Google Ads-Verwaltungskonten haben, auf die Sie über die Google Ads API zugreifen. Wenn Sie ein Aktualisierungstoken für Ihre Anwendung generieren, authentifizieren Sie Ihre Google Ads API-Anwendung in der Regel mit einer dieser E-Mail-Adressen.

Wir empfehlen dringend, Aliasse für gemeinsame Teams zu verwenden, damit Sie den Zugriff auf diese Konten nicht verlieren, wenn einzelne Teammitglieder das Team wechseln oder das Unternehmen verlassen. Im Rest dieser Anleitung wird auf jede der oben aufgeführten E-Mails eingegangen und es wird erläutert, wie Sie sie so aktualisieren können, dass anstelle der E-Mail-Adresse eines einzelnen Nutzers ein gemeinsamer Teamalias verwendet wird.

E-Mail-Adresse für Google Ads API-Kontakt

Die Kontakt-E-Mail-Adresse für die Google Ads API ist eine E-Mail-Adresse, die Sie bei der Registrierung für die Google Ads API angeben. Sie sollten sicherstellen, dass Sie Zugriff auf diesen Alias haben, und regelmäßig die an diese Adresse gesendeten E‑Mails prüfen. Google verwendet diese E-Mail-Adresse, um Ihr Team bei API-Überprüfungen, Prüfanfragen oder Produktionsnotfällen zu kontaktieren, die sofortige Aufmerksamkeit erfordern. Verwenden Sie einen gemeinsamen Teamalias als Kontakt-E-Mail-Adresse, damit das gesamte Team diese Benachrichtigungen erhält.

So aktualisieren Sie die Kontakt-E-Mail-Adresse für die API:

  1. Melden Sie sich in Ihrem Google Ads-Verwaltungskonto an.

  2. Klicken Sie links unten auf Verwaltung.

  3. Klicken Sie unter Einstellungen des Verwaltungskontos auf API-Center.

  4. Notieren Sie sich unter Entwicklerdetails die E-Mail-Adresse für API-Kontakte. Klicken Sie auf den Abwärtspfeil und bearbeiten Sie die E‑Mail-Adresse. Klicken Sie auf Speichern.

Google Cloud Console-Konto

Das Google API Console-Projekt enthält die OAuth-Anmeldedaten Ihrer Anwendung und steuert den Zugriff auf die Google Ads API. Sorgen Sie dafür, dass Sie auf dieses Konto zugreifen können, indem Sie ein gemeinsames Alias zum Kontoinhaber machen.

So aktualisieren Sie den Inhaber des Google API Console-Projekts:

  • Melden Sie sich in der Google API Console an.
  • Wählen Sie Ihr Projekt oben links auf der Seite im Drop-down-Menü aus.
  • Rufen Sie im Menü links IAM und Verwaltung > IAM auf.
  • Klicken Sie auf die Schaltfläche Zugriff gewähren.
  • Geben Sie die gemeinsame E-Mail-Adresse im Bereich Hauptkonten hinzufügen ein.
  • Weisen Sie die Rolle Inhaber zu.
  • Klicken Sie auf Speichern. Weitere Informationen zum Erteilen und Widerrufen des Zugriffs finden Sie in der Cloud-Dokumentation.

Google Ads-Verwaltungskonto

Eine gängige Methode zum Verwalten von Konten mit der Google Ads API besteht darin, alle Konten mit einem gemeinsamen Verwaltungskonto zu verknüpfen und API-Aufrufe für alle Konten mit den Anmeldedaten des obersten Verwaltungskontos auszuführen. In dieser Konfiguration:

  • Der Entwickler stellt ein Aktualisierungstoken mit den Anmeldedaten eines Nutzers aus, der Zugriff auf das Google Ads-Verwaltungskonto hat.
  • Der Entwickler legt den login_customer_id-Header als Kunden-ID des Google Ads-Verwaltungskontos und den customer_id-Header als Kunden-ID des Kontos fest, an das API-Aufrufe gesendet werden.

Ein potenzielles Risiko dieser Einrichtung besteht darin, dass alle API-Aufrufe fehlschlagen, wenn der autorisierte Nutzer den Zugriff auf das Google Ads-Verwaltungskonto verliert, da das Aktualisierungstoken dann nicht mehr gültig ist. Um dies zu vermeiden, können Sie einen gemeinsamen E-Mail-Alias einladen, dieses Google Ads-Verwaltungskonto mit den entsprechenden Zugriffsebenen zu verwalten. Verwenden Sie diesen gemeinsamen E‑Mail-Alias, um das Aktualisierungstoken für API-Aufrufe auszugeben.